The spotlight isn't only on the game's biggest stars, but also on the next generation ready to break through on soccer's biggest stage.
The Young Player Award World Cup winner goes to the best-performing player in the tournament who is 21 years old or younger.
With the 2026 World Cup quickly approaching, anticipating is building around who is going to be the breakthrough player.
Here are all the winners of the Young Player Award.
During the 2022 World Cup, Enzo Fernandez was 21 years old starting the tournament on the sidelines. However, his breakthrough came during the 87th minute of the group stage game scoring against Mexico.
Fernandez ended up starting in five out of his seven appearances for Argentina, playing for a total of 563 minutes. Argentina defeated France to win the 2022 World Cup.
Kylian Mbappe is widely known as one of the best soccer players in the world. In the 2018 World Cup, he scored four goals in seven appearances.
Mbappe played a critical role in France's success, ultimately helping them win the tournament. He became the first teenager (19) to score in a World Cup Final since Pele in 1958.
Paul Pogba had a breakthrough international tournament at the 2014 World Cup, at age 21. In five appearances, Pogba scored one goal and had an assist for France.
He scored a vital goal in the 79th minute against Nigeria to break a scoreless tie against Nigeria, sending France to the quarterfinals.
Thomas Muller was called up to Germany's national team in 2010. At just 20 years old, he scored five goals and had three assists during the World Cup.
Muller also won the Golden Boot award as the tournament's top scorer in 2010. It was a historic breakthrough for Thomas Mullers in his Germany debut.
Lukas Podolski was the first ever Young Player Award winner. At 21 years old, he scored three goals in seven appearances for Germany. In Germany's match against Sweden in the Round of 16, Podolski scored both goals to secure the 2-0 win.
Podolski was a dominant striker, renowned for his explosive pace and powerful left foot. He played a critical role in the 2014 World Cup helping Germany win the tournament.
